Verdict Should you buy it?

A setting mist built on alcohol denat. with avobenzone, homosalate, octisalate, and octocrylene plus a titanium dioxide tint. Citrus and spearmint essential oils, geraniol, limonene, and terpineol layer aromatic compounds on a drying base.

Pros
  • Doubles as a makeup-setting mist with a tinted, natural finish
  • Antioxidants tetrahexyldecyl ascorbate and tocopherol included
  • Sodium hyaluronate and polyglutamic acid offer surface hydration
Cons
  • Alcohol denat. high in the INCI can feel stripping
  • Citrus, spearmint, geraniol, limonene, terpineol drive allergen exposure
  • Mist format complicates achieving label SPF on skin

Who it's for: Makeup wearers wanting an aromatic SPF refresh who tolerate ethanol and fragrant botanical oils.

Fragrance-free No synthetic perfume added. Not FDA-defined in the US; the EU requires 'Parfum' + the 26 named allergens on the label. 'Unscented' differs — may contain masking fragrance. Botanical oils still scent.
Yes
Alcohol-free No drying short-chain alcohols (alcohol denat., SD alcohol, ethanol). Does not refer to fatty alcohols like cetyl or stearyl alcohol, which are emollients.
No
